An oxide‐zeolite (ZnCr 2 O 4 ‐ZSM‐5) catalyst for directly converting CO 2 to aromatics was designed and developed. It showed high PX/X (the C‐mol ratio of p ‐xylene to all xylene) and PX/aromatics (the C‐mol ratio of p ‐xylene to aromatics) ratios, which reached 97.3 and 63.9 %, respectively.
